DOCUMENTARY STYLE PHOTOGRAPHY COURSE
Students shall be trained to prepare Photo Essays after being taught on the various styles via the works of different photographers, the equipment needed, the techniques to be executed, use of flash and filters. The students shall learn how to select the images for the final story and assembling the finished photo essay. Students may like to have their images taken during the shoot to be scanned into Kodak PhotoCD and have the chance to use the Society’s large format Epson Stylus 7600 professional printer for printing. Upon completion of the course, the students are required to submit a portfolio of 6 pictures for assessment. A course certificate will be issued to students who clear the assessment.

Course Syllabus
(Students of this course must have knowledge of the use of a 35mm camera)

1. A study on the works of selected well-known photojournalists. How to create a picture story. What makes a memorable photograph? Equipment needed. What film to use? Techniques covered: uprating and downrating of film speeds, Push & Pull process. Use of digital technology. Shooting candids. Preparing for a shoot.

2. Flash techniques: fill-in, bounced flash, use of 2 flashes, slow sync flash. Use of Filters for image enhancement.

3. Field trips taking pictures in day time. Applying techniques learned in the course.

4. Field trips taking pictures in night time. Applying techniques learned in the course.

5. Photo review and critique. Selecting the images for the picture story.

6. Photo review and critique. Assembling the finished photo essay.
